Hi I am new to this list and I am trying to find out about Matthew John SULLIVAN. In 1917 he married Annie M FAUNT and was living in Randwick. In 1916 his step son Thomas Joseph FAUNT enlisted in WW1 and gave Mathew's address as Oberon St, Randwick. Annie FAUNT nee COLLINS had at least 4 children before marrying Matthew SULLIVAN in 1917. They were Henry FAUNT b1896, Thomas Joseph FAUNT b1899 Cootamundra NSW, Caroline FAUNT b1902 Cootamundra, Rose K FAUNT b1905 Sydney and sometime after 1905 a daughter Noreen. Annie SULLIVAN nee FAUNT nee COLLINS died in 1918 and was buried in the Church of England Cemetery Randwick. Any information on this family would be greatly appreciated. Regards Dianne Myers
